Receiving oral sex is ZERO risk for HIV. No one has ever been infected with HIV from receiving oral sex.  Risks are:
1) having unprotected, insertive anal or vaginal sex, or
2) sharing IV drug needles with IV drug users.

That is all - nothing else you can think of is a risk for HIV.
